A diesel like no
other |
|
In the BMW 320d, an unlikely brew provides an
intoxicating drive |
|
By Brian Afuang
Here’s a bit of trivia:
Strictly speaking “diesel” refers to a type of engine invented
by a bloke named Rudolph Diesel and not specifically to the brew
used to fuel it. Fact is, a diesel engine could actually run on
either a petroleum-based fuel—which eventually became widely known
as “diesel” too—or on a variety of plant-based oils including
those used in cooking French fries in. Vin Diesel, meanwhile, is a
Hollywood ham actor who has had a string of commercially successful
flicks, while I haven’t the foggiest idea how the clothing brand
Diesel came about.
What has these got to do with
everything? Not much, really. All I care is diesel—both engine and
fuel—can be such potently thrilling stuff when they’re used in
powering BMW’s 320d. Hell, yeah.
